Determining A Banshee 350 Price Guide: What's It's Worth?
Figuring out the fair price of a used Yamaha Banshee 350 can be quite challenging. These spirited two-stroke ATVs are extremely sought-after, but its value fluctuates substantially based on various factors. Condition is key, with well-maintained machines fetching the best dollars. Hours also plays a large role, even a few collectors prioritize authenticity over limited wear. Accessories availability and some modifications will further impact the final figure. As a general estimate, expect to see anywhere from $5,000 to $12,000+, based to these considerations.
The Quad 350 Top Rate: What Quick Can She Actually Travel?
So, you're intrigued about what a Banshee 350 performs in terms of unadulterated speed. The truth is quite complex. While claimed figures often hover around 95-105 miles per hour, the practical top rate you'll achieve on a Quad 350 depends on a number of variables. Things like rubber condition, elevation, motor tuning – specifically exhaust changes – and even rider weight all factor a significant part. A factory Quad 350, in perfect situations, might reach those minimum figures. However, with some performance modifications, it’s not rare to see speeds surpassing 110 miles per hour, and some enthusiastic tuners have even reportedly pushed them way further. Buying a Big Wheel Banshee 350: What to Check For
So, you're considering about buying a Yamaha Banshee 350? Fantastic! These two-stroke ATVs are legendary for their power, but finding a good one requires thorough inspection. Initially, scrutinize the engine. Look for indications of overheating such as burnt plastics or some gritty residue under the spark plug. Then, give close consideration to the suspension; damaged bushings and low shocks are frequent issues. Don't skip the temperature system – confirm the radiator is free of debris and the hoses are in sound condition. Finally, evaluate the overall state of the fairings; significant cracks can point to a harsh past. A mechanical inspection by a experienced specialist is always suggested before making your acquisition.
Yamaha Machine 350 Specs & Handling Aspects
The Yamaha Banshee 350, a legendary performance quad, boasts impressive details that contributed to its iconic status. Its heart is a 347cc, two-stroke, liquid-cooled engine, delivering a substantial torque that many riders remember fondly. Typically, power is calculated around 36 horsepower, though this can vary based on modifications and overall condition. The machine features a five-speed manual transmission and a chain configuration, allowing for direct response and a thrilling riding experience. With a unladen weight of approximately 235 pounds, the Banshee offers a advantageous performance-to-weight ratio, contributing to its responsiveness on the course. Additionally, the suspension system, featuring dual shocks in the rear and a double A-arm setup in the front, was engineered to handle rough environments, although its age may necessitate periodic maintenance.
